    The aim is to establish some theorems on existence, uniqueness, and asymptotic stability for the differential (linear) problem of heat conduction in a rigid body. We provide a statement of the second law of thermodynamics in order to take into account the dissipation effects on the boundary. Then we derive the restrictions imposed by the second law on the relaxation function.
